Across Protocol offers 4 features including Intent-based bridging with ~5-second Solana transfer finality, Zero security exploits across $27B+ in lifetime volume, Embedded cross-chain actions for direct Solana DeFi deposits, and 1 more. GetBlock counters with 5 features including Solana RPC among 100+ chains, Shared multi-tenant nodes, Dedicated private nodes, and 2 more.
